What is the difference between Remote Embedded Systems vs Remote Firmware Engineer?

AspectRemote Embedded SystemsRemote Firmware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related; knowledge of embedded hardware and softwareBachelor's in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related; expertise in firmware development and microcontroller programming
Work EnvironmentDesigning, developing, and testing embedded hardware/software systems remotelyWriting, testing, and debugging firmware for embedded devices remotely
Employer & Industry UsageElectronics, automotive, IoT, consumer devicesConsumer electronics, IoT, industrial automation

Remote Embedded Systems professionals focus on designing and integrating embedded hardware and software, while Remote Firmware Engineers specialize in developing firmware for microcontrollers and embedded chips. Both roles require similar technical skills and often overlap, but their core responsibilities differ in scope and focus.

Software Engineer - Embedded Systems & Computer Vision

Fulcrum Air

Calgary, AB • On-site, Remote

Full-time

Posted yesterday


Job description

FulcrumAir | Calgary, Alberta

Company Overview:FulcrumAir is a world leader in UAV and Aerial Robotics Technology for the power line industry. Our unique and innovative technology is creating safer, more efficient, and more environmentally responsible alternatives for traditional power line work methods.


Position Overview

We are seeking a skilled and driven Software Engineer to join our R&D team. The ideal candidate brings solid embedded software development experience with a strong focus on Computer Vision, and a passion for applying these skills to cutting-edge UAV and robotics platforms. You will be working in a creative, fast-paced "Skunkworks"-style environment - minimal bureaucracy, maximum freedom - where your work directly shapes industry-changing products.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design and develop control firmware for robotics and UAV platforms
  • Develop and optimize algorithms for real-time image processing and decision-making on embedded systems, with attention to latency, memory, and power constraints
  • Aid in the development of remote control applications (Qt - Windows and Android)
  • Aid in the development of web-based tooling to support operations in the field
  • Support firmware release and deployment through automated testing and CI/CD pipeline development
  • Collaborate closely with hardware engineers, robotics experts, and product managers to integrate software solutions seamlessly into our platforms
  • Document design decisions, implementation details, and research findings to support internal knowledge sharing

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Software Engineering,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or a related field
  • 3+ years of experience developing embedded software in C or C++
  • Demonstrated experience developing Computer Vision applications (e.g., OpenCV, image processing pipelines, object detection, or similar)
  • Experience with machine learning frameworks (TensorFlow, PyTorch) and deploying models on embedded or edge hardware
  • Driven - you are excited by hard problems and motivated to find elegant, reliable solutions.
  • Self-starter - you take ownership of your work and actively identify the needs and priorities of the team

Beneficial Skills (Nice to Haves)

  • Familiarity with CI/CD workflows and automated testing frameworks (e.g., GitLab CI)
  • Experience with wireless radios and antenna systems
  • Practical prototyping and troubleshooting skills: soldering, oscilloscope use, schematic reading
  • Familiarity with JavaScript, HTML, CSS, Node, or Vue
  • Keen interest in drones, robotics, and unmanned systems
